What is a gantry crane?

A gantry crane is industrial lifting equipment designed to move heavy loads. It consists of two vertical legs (full gantry crane) or a single vertical leg (semi-gantry crane) and a horizontal beam. This structure enables the hoist to move along the crossbeam to lift and transport loads. It usually runs on rails fixed to the ground.

 

What are the types of gantry cranes?

Industrial gantry cranes include full gantry cranes and semi-gantry cranes. There are also similar devices, such as port cranes for loading and unloading ships, and rubber-tired gantry cranes, also widely used in ports. For occasional or temporary work, there are portable or adjustable gantry cranes.

Full gantry crane

These have the same functionality as overhead cranes, but are configured with two legs. The rails are located at ground level, usually fixed to a concrete slab, concrete foundation or specially designed steel girders.

Semi-gantry cranes

Semi-gantry cranes are configured with a single leg. The first rail is positioned high up on the structure, and the second rail is positioned at floor level.

Frequently asked questions

01.
Why install a rail for a gantry crane?

A : The rail is required for proper operation in an industrial environment.


  1. Alignment: The rail ensures straight crane travel, avoiding deviations caused by uneven ground or imbalance caused by the weight of the load.
  2. Wheel wear: The rail ensures even distribution of wheel wear, extending equipment life and reducing maintenance costs.
02.
How are the rails installed?

A : Rail installation varies according to capacity and environment
Here are a few common methods :


  1. Capacities of 5 tons and less: For indoor installation, the rails can be placed and fixed to the concrete slab.
  2. High capacitites or outdoors: The rails can be laid on a steel beam fixed to the ground or on a concrete foundation designed specifically to receive the rail.
  3. Other option: The rails can also be embedded in the foundation.
03.
Does a gantry crane cost less than an outdoor overhead crane?
 A : No, a gantry crane does not cost less than an outdoor overhead crane. Although a gantry crane requires less structure, the overall cost of acquisition and installation is generally higher. 04.
How do you power a gantry crane?

  A : Gantry crane run on electricity.
Here are some methods of powering them :

  1. Conductor bars: Just like an overhead crane, conductor bars can be installed to provide the necessary electricity.
  2. Cable reels: It's also common to see cable reels used to power gantry cranes.

It's important not to overlook the position of the conductor bars or the cable reels, as this can have a significant impact on your production.

05.
What are the advatanges of a gantry crane?

 A : The workstation and load shifting

  1. Workstation: In the industrial environment, gantry cranes are used to feed a machine or create a workstation without disrupting the operations of overhead cranes positioned on the upper level.
  2. Load shifting: They also allow material to be moved between two overhead crane bays, or to transport loads between two sections of your plant where the installation of an overhead crane is not possible.
06.
What are inconveniences of a gantry crane?

A : Storage limitation and traffic conflicts

  1. Storage limitation: The gantry crane limits the possibility of storage in the areas where it circulates, as the ground rails must remain free at all times.
  2. Traffic conflicts: There is a possibility of conflict between the gantry crane and areas of pedestrian or forklift traffic, which can pose safety issues.
